It depends entirely on the product, and this is a question worth asking, because the answer to whether descaling solution is safe for drinking water lines is written on the label if you know what to look for. A tankless water heater is not a closed appliance like a coffee maker. Whatever you circulate through it touches the same heat exchanger and piping that delivers water to your taps. This article explains the certification that governs exactly this situation.

Why the question matters more than people think

When you flush a water heater, you circulate an acid solution through the unit for 30 to 90 minutes, then rinse. The rinse removes the bulk of the solution, but no rinse removes 100% of anything from a system with that much internal surface area. Trace residue stays behind and goes out the hot tap over the following days.

With vinegar, nobody worries, and rightly so. It is food. With a jug of unlabeled descaler from an industrial supplier, you are trusting that the manufacturer formulated it with potable systems in mind. Some did. Some formulated it for boilers and cooling towers that never touch drinking water, and those products can carry corrosion inhibitors and other additives you do not want in a glass of water.

What NSF/ANSI/CAN 60 actually is

NSF/ANSI/CAN 60 is the North American standard titled Drinking Water Treatment Chemicals - Health Effects. It was developed after the U.S. EPA moved additive evaluation to independent standards bodies in the 1980s, and it establishes minimum health effects requirements for chemicals used in drinking water treatment, verifying that chemicals added to drinking water do not pose unacceptable health risks (NSF’s overview of the standard covers its history and scope).

Certification is not a paperwork exercise. The certifying laboratory reviews the full formulation, including impurities and trace contaminants, tests the product at its maximum use level, and audits the manufacturing facility. The standard covers scale and corrosion control chemicals among its categories, which is precisely the family a water heater descaler belongs to.

The practical translation: a descaler certified to NSF/ANSI/CAN 60 has been independently verified safe for use in systems that feed drinking water taps, at the dosages on its label.

The certified column is a short list

Here is what surprises people who go looking: most descaling products sold for water heaters are not certified. Certification is expensive and slow, and many manufacturers simply skip it and rely on phrases like “food-grade” or “safe formula,” which are marketing language, not verified claims. The verification habit to build: find the NSF mark on the label, then look the product up in NSF’s public listing database. If it is not in the database, it is not certified, whatever the label implies.

Where vinegar fits in this picture

Vinegar occupies a comfortable middle ground. It is not certified to anything, and it does not need to be, because it is a food product with no mystery ingredients. If you flush with household or cleaning-strength vinegar and rinse normally, safety is not a concern. The safety question arises specifically with formulated descalers, because their contents vary and their labels do not always say much. That is the gap the certification exists to close.

A note on rinsing, whatever you use

Regardless of the product, finish every flush with a fresh water rinse of 5 to 10 minutes through the service ports, then run the hot taps in the house for a minute or two once the system is back online. The bottom line

Vinegar: safe, no certification needed. Formulated descalers: safe if certified to NSF/ANSI/CAN 60 and used per label, an open question if not. For a heater that feeds drinking water taps, the certification is the difference between verified and assumed, and verified costs you nothing but reading the label.
